The sad thing is that they have the math wrong. Whether you live or die depends more on what the other person is driving than what you are. Car vs. car both people live, truck vs. truck both people die. The extra mass isn't making you safer, it's just killing the other guy because there is a limit to how much total force crumple zones and other safety features can absorb. |
